Arrest Report, November 13, 2019

11/13/2019

St. Mary Parish Sheriff Blaise Smith advises that over the last 24-hour reporting period, the Sheriff's Office responded to 24 complaints and reports the following arrests:

 

Chance Colbert Joseph Boudreaux, 25, 427 North Sterling Street, Lafayette, LA, was arrested on November 13, 2019, at 10:54 pm for driving on roadway laned for traffic, possession of marijuana, and possession of drug paraphernalia.

A deputy was patrolling the area of Highway 182 near Berwick when he observed a vehicle cross the fog line several times.  The deputy conducted a traffic stop and made contact with the driver, Boudreaux. Through the stop, drugs and drug paraphernalia were found.  Boudreaux was arrested and released on a summons to appear on February 7, 2019.

 

Robert Charles Rabb, 43, 106 Billiot Lane, Bayou Vista, LA, was arrested on November 13, 2019, at 1:04 am on a warrant for failure to appear on the charge of criminal neglect of family.

A deputy was conducting building checks in the area of South and Field Road when he observed a subject that he knew held an active warrant for his arrest. The deputy made contact with the subject, Rabb, and advised him of the active warrant. Rabb was transported to the St. Mary Parish Law Enforcement Center for booking.  Bail was set at $1,157.

 

K9 DIVISION

Kimberly Marie Bergeron, 28, 103 Sunnyside Lane, Morgan City, LA, was arrested on November 12, 2019, at 7:10 pm on the following charges:

-        Turning movements and required signals

-        Possession of schedule II drugs (2 counts)

-        Possession of drug paraphernalia

-        Possession of CDS in the presence of person under age 17

A deputy was patrolling Highway 90 East near Patterson when he observed a vehicle fail to give a proper signal. The deputy conducted a traffic stop and made contact with the driver, Bergeron. During the stop, a K9 deputy arrived on the scene and K9 Vickie was deployed for an open-air sniff, in which she showed a positive response on the vehicle. Drugs were subsequently located in the vehicle. Bergeron was transported to the St. Mary Parish Law Enforcement Center for booking and was later released on a $1,500 bond.
